President Staffan Nilsson

President, European Economic and Social Committee

Biography

President Staffan Nilsson has been serving as the President of the European Economic and Social Committee (EESC) since October 2010.  Prior to this appointment, he served in Group III (Various Interests) for a period of twelve years - six years as Vice President, and another six as President.

Since becoming a member of the EESC in 1995, Mr. Nilsson has devoted much of his expertise to the fields of agriculture, sustainable development, civic engagement, and international cooperation. He is strongly committed to a “new” Europe, and over the course of his career, has consistently highlighted the need for dialogue, openness, and inclusive cooperation for sustained growth and stability in the continent. Mr. Nilsson has also been an active member of the EESC Joint Consultative Committees for many years. He is currently playing a vital role in the EU-Turkey JCC and the Euromed Committee.

In addition, Mr. Nilsson has been a Rapporteur for opinions on a number of forums including the Soil Protection Framework Directive, the Action plan for Environmental Technology, and the Communication on the Sustainable Use of Pesticides, Agriculture and Food Safety in the Context of the Euromed Partnership. He has over 30 years of experience in farming in Northern Sweden, and is an active member of the Federation of Swedish Farmers (LRF).
